Opinion: Amid a huge, diverse field of candidates, it looks like Democrats want plain-vanilla Joe Biden to contest 2020’s election against Donald Trump, writes DanHenninger

Joe Biden has opened up a 21-length lead over the 20 or so other ponies running to challenge the big horse, Donald Trump, in the 2020 presidential derby.

Some might say the Trump-Biden matchup was preordained, given the Democrats’ motley crew of candidates. Who’d have thought politics at this level could be contested by the mayor of South Bend, Ind., or a House member from Hawaii?
